dialog::backdrop{background:rgba(var(--cd__fill-1),.5)}.header__icon--menu{position:initial}.js menu-drawer>details>summary:before,.js menu-drawer>details[open]:not(.menu-opening)>summary:before{content:"";position:absolute;cursor:default;width:100%;height:calc(100vh - 100%);height:calc(var(--viewport-height, 100vh) - (var(--header-bottom-position, 100%)));top:100%;left:0;background:rgba(var(--cd__fill-1),.5);opacity:0;visibility:hidden;z-index:2;transition:opacity 0s,visibility 0s}menu-drawer>details[open]>summary:before{visibility:visible;opacity:1;transition:opacity var(--duration-default) ease,visibility var(--duration-default) ease}dialog.menu-drawer{position:absolute;transform:translate(-100%);opacity:0;z-index:3;left:0;top:100%;width:100%;height:calc(var(--viewport-height, 100vh) - (var(--header-bottom-position, 100%)));margin:0;padding:0;background-color:var(--cl__fill-1);transition:transform var(--duration-default) ease,opacity var(--duration-default) ease;border:none}dialog[open].menu-drawer{transform:translate(0);opacity:1}dialog[open].menu-drawer{transform:translate(-100%);opacity:1;visibility:visible}dialog[open].menu-drawer.menu-drawer--open{transform:translate(0);transition:transform var(--duration-default) ease,opacity var(--duration-default) ease}.header__icon-close-menu{position:absolute;top:-12px;transform:translateY(-100%);left:var(--side-padding);display:flex;background:var(--cl__fill-1)}.js details[open]>.menu-drawer__submenu{transition:transform var(--duration-default) ease,visibility var(--duration-default) ease}.no-js details[open]>.menu-drawer,.js details[open].menu-opening>.menu-drawer,details[open].menu-opening>.menu-drawer__submenu{transform:translate(0);visibility:visible}.js .menu-drawer__navigation .submenu-open{visibility:hidden}@media screen and (min-width: 750px){.menu-drawer{width:25rem;border-width:0 var(--drawer-border-width) 0 0;border-style:solid;border-color:var(--c__grey-20);border-top:none}.menu-drawer .menu-drawer__navigation{border-top-color:var(--c__grey-20)}.no-js .menu-drawer{height:auto}}.menu-drawer__inner-container{position:relative;height:100%}.menu-drawer__navigation-container{display:grid;grid-template-rows:1fr auto;align-content:space-between;overflow-y:auto;height:100%}.menu-drawer__navigation{border-top:1px solid var(--c__grey-30)}.menu-drawer__inner-submenu{height:100%;overflow-x:hidden;overflow-y:auto}.no-js .menu-drawer__navigation{padding:0}.no-js .menu-drawer__navigation>ul>li{border-bottom:.06rem solid rgba(var(--cl__high-contrast),.04)}.no-js .menu-drawer__submenu ul>li{border-top:.06rem solid rgba(var(--cl__high-contrast),.04)}.menu-drawer__menu>li{margin-bottom:0}.menu-drawer__menu .list-menu__item{font-size:.875rem;font-family:var(--font-body);font-weight:400;line-height:150%;letter-spacing:.01em;padding:16px calc(40px + var(--side-padding)) 16px var(--side-padding);border-bottom:1px solid var(--c__grey-30)}@media (min-width: 478px){.menu-drawer__menu .list-menu__item{font-size:1rem}}.menu-drawer__menu .menu-drawer__menu-item{font-weight:400;position:relative;width:100%}.menu-drawer__menu .menu-drawer__menu-item strong{font-weight:500}.menu-drawer__menu .menu-drawer__menu-item--product_link .menu-drawer__menu-item{padding:16px var(--side-padding) 16px 12px;display:flex;width:100%}.menu-drawer__menu .menu-drawer__menu-item--product_link .menu-drawer__menu-item-label{display:flex;flex-direction:column;flex-wrap:wrap;row-gap:0}@media (min-width: 375px){.menu-drawer__menu .menu-drawer__menu-item--product_link .menu-drawer__menu-item-label{flex-direction:row;align-items:center}}.menu-drawer__menu .menu-drawer__menu-item--product_link .menu-drawer__menu-item--product-no-image{padding-left:var(--side-padding)}.menu-drawer__menu .menu-drawer__menu-item--product_link img{grid-column:1/2;grid-row:1/3;width:32px;height:32px;margin-right:12px}.menu-drawer__menu--main .list-menu__item{background-color:var(--cl__fill-1)}.menu-drawer__menu--main summary.menu-drawer__menu-item{font-weight:500}.menu-drawer__menu--secondary .list-menu__item{background-color:var(--cl__fill-2)}.menu-drawer__menu-item{padding:.69rem 1.88rem;text-decoration:none;font-size:1.13rem}.no-js .menu-drawer__menu-item{font-size:1rem}.no-js .menu-drawer__submenu .menu-drawer__menu-item{padding:.75rem 3.25rem .75rem 3.75rem}.no-js .menu-drawer__submenu .menu-drawer__submenu .menu-drawer__menu-item{padding-left:5.63rem}.menu-drawer summary.menu-drawer__menu-item{padding-right:3.25rem}.menu-drawer__menu-item>.icon-arrow,.menu-drawer__menu-item>.icon-caret{position:absolute;right:var(--side-padding);top:50%;transform:translatey(-50%) rotate(-90deg);height:8px;width:auto}.js .menu-drawer__submenu{position:absolute;top:0;width:100%;bottom:0;left:0;background-color:var(--cl__fill-1);z-index:1;transform:translate(100%);visibility:hidden}.js .menu-drawer__submenu .menu-drawer__submenu{overflow-y:auto}.menu-drawer__close-button{font-size:1rem;font-family:var(--font-body);font-weight:400;line-height:150%;letter-spacing:.01em;border-bottom:1px solid var(--c__grey-30);padding:16px calc(40px + var(--side-padding));width:100%;position:relative;background-color:var(--cl__fill-2);text-decoration:none;font-weight:500}.menu-drawer__close-button .icon-caret{position:absolute;top:50%;height:8px;width:auto;left:var(--side-padding);right:auto;transform:translatey(-50%) rotate(90deg)}.no-js .menu-drawer__close-button{display:none}.menu-drawer__close-button .icon-arrow{transform:rotate(180deg);margin-right:.63rem}.menu-drawer__utility-links{padding:1rem var(--side-padding);background-color:var(--cd__fill-1);color:var(--cd__high-contrast);position:relative;display:flex;flex-direction:row;flex-wrap:wrap;gap:20px 28px;padding-right:140px}.menu-drawer__utility-links a:focus{outline:2px solid var(--cd__high-contrast);outline-offset:2px}.menu-drawer__account{font-size:.875rem;font-family:var(--font-body);font-weight:400;line-height:150%;letter-spacing:.01em;display:inline-flex;align-items:center;text-decoration:none;color:var(--cd__high-contrast);margin-bottom:0}.menu-drawer__account svg.icon-account{width:20px;height:32px}.menu-drawer__account svg.icon-account path{fill:var(--cd__high-contrast)}.menu-drawer__utility-links:has(.menu-drawer__localization) .menu-drawer__account{margin:0}.menu-drawer__account .icon-account{height:1.25rem;width:1.25rem;margin-right:.63rem}.menu-drawer__account:hover .icon-account{transform:scale(1.07)}.menu-drawer .list-social{justify-content:flex-start}.menu-drawer .list-social:empty{display:none}.menu-drawer .list-social__link{color:var(--cd__high-contrast);padding:0}.menu-drawer .list-social__item{padding:0}.menu-drawer .list-social__item+.list-social__item{margin-left:32px}.menu-drawer .list-social__item .icon{height:32px;width:32px}#extole_zone_mobile_menu div{font-size:.875rem;font-family:var(--font-body);font-weight:400;line-height:150%;letter-spacing:.01em;padding:16px calc(40px + var(--side-padding)) 16px var(--side-padding);border-bottom:1px solid var(--c__grey-30);color:initial!important;margin-bottom:0!important}@media (min-width: 478px){#extole_zone_mobile_menu div{font-size:1rem}}#extole_zone_mobile_menu div a:hover{color:rgba(var(--color-foreground),.75)}
/*# sourceMappingURL=/cdn/shop/t/572/assets/component-menu-drawer.css.map */
